推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了Linux服务器的安装过程,从入门基础知识到高级技巧,涵盖图解步骤,旨在帮助读者轻松掌握Linux服务器的安装与配置。
本文目录导读:
在当今信息化时代,Linux 服务器因其稳定性、安全性和灵活性,被广泛应用于各种场合,本文将为您详细介绍Linux服务器的安装过程,帮助您快速掌握安装技巧。
准备工作
1、准备Linux发行版:本文以CentOS 7为例,因为CentOS在国内拥有较高的用户基础。
2、准备安装介质:可以是光盘、U盘或者硬盘。
3、准备BIOS设置:确保BIOS支持从所选介质启动。
4、准备网络环境:确保服务器可以连接到互联网。
安装步骤
1、制作启动盘
将Linux发行版的ISO文件刻录到光盘或复制到U盘,您可以使用UltraISO等软件进行操作。
2、设置BIOS
重启服务器,进入BIOS设置,将启动顺序调整为从所选介质(光盘或U盘)启动。
3、启动安装程序
插入启动盘,重启服务器,屏幕将显示Linux安装程序的启动界面,选择“Install CentOS 7”开始安装。
4、选择安装类型
在安装过程中,您可以选择“服务器版”或“工作站版”,服务器版适用于服务器环境,工作站版适用于桌面环境。
5、分区操作
安装程序将自动为您创建分区,如果您有特殊需求,可以手动分区,建议至少创建以下分区:
- /boot:引导分区,建议大小为1GB。
- /:根分区,建议大小为10GB。
- /home:用户家目录分区,可以根据实际需求设置大小。
- /var:变量分区,建议大小为5GB。
- /tmp:临时分区,建议大小为2GB。
6、配置网络
在安装过程中,系统会提示您配置网络,确保选择“自动连接到网络”,并输入正确的网络信息。
7、选择时区
根据您的地理位置,选择合适的时区。
8、设置root密码
在安装过程中,您需要为root用户设置密码,确保密码足够复杂,以保障服务器安全。
9、安装附加包
在安装过程中,您可以选择安装一些附加包,如开发工具、Web服务器等。
10、完成安装
安装完成后,重启服务器,在启动过程中,按提示删除启动盘。
安装后的配置
1、设置IP地址
进入系统后,使用以下命令设置静态IP地址:
vi /etc/sysconfig/network-scripts/ifcfg-ens33
修改以下参数:
BOOTPROTO=static IPADDR=192.168.1.100 NETMASK=255.255.255.0 GATEWAY=192.168.1.1 DNS1=8.8.8.8 DNS2=8.8.4.4
重启网络服务:
systemctl restart network
2、配置Yum源
使用以下命令配置Yum源:
m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o
更新Yum缓存:
yum clean all yum makecache
3、安装必要的软件
使用以下命令安装必要的软件:
yum install -y epel-release yum install -y vim net-tools telnet wget curl zip unzip
4、配置防火墙
使用以下命令配置防火墙:
firewall-cmd --zone=public --add-port=22/tcp --permanent firewall-cmd --zone=public --add-port=80/tcp --permanent firewall-cmd --zone=public --add-port=443/tcp --permanent firewall-cmd --reload
5、配置Selinux
使用以下命令配置Selinux:
setenforce 0 vi /etc/selinux/config
将以下参数设置为disabled:
SELINUX=disabled
重启服务器。
通过本文的介绍,您已经掌握了Linux服务器的安装和基本配置,在实际应用中,您可以根据需求进行更多的定制和优化,希望这篇文章能对您有所帮助。
以下为50个中文相关关键词:
Linux, 服务器, 安装教程, CentOS, 发行版, 启动盘, BIOS, 安装类型, 分区, 网络配置, 时区, root密码, 附加包, 配置, IP地址, Yum源, 软件安装, 防火墙, Selinux, 稳定性, 安全性, 灵活性, 信息化时代, 服务器环境, 桌面环境, 引导分区, 根分区, 用户家目录, 变量分区, 临时分区, 自动连接, 时区选择, 密码设置, 附加软件, 安装完成, 重启, 静态IP, Yum缓存, 必要软件, 防火墙配置, Selinux配置, 定制, 优化, 实际应用, 助手, 指导, 教程, 详细步骤, 实用技巧
本文标签属性:
Linux服务器安装:linux服务器安装图形化界面
入门到精通:入门到精通有几个等级
linux 服务器安装教程:linux服务器安装gui